Dear Amelia,

Your dad is extremely protective over me. He always has been. So it came as no surprise that he was pissed when I told him I was face to face with with Claudia, and then blocked him out. It was reckless of me, but I knew I’d be okay.

When I got back, I knew I had to tell him that his two childhood best friends were the ones working with Katrina and Ryan. He was already suspicious of them, after all, he was the one who first suspected them. We just both really hoped we were wrong.

We went to Willow Lake, and I brought everyone together. Leon, Sadie, Alex, Devyn, Jordan, Stella, Farrah and the two team leads, Miranda and Christopher. Once we were all together, I explained everything. I planned to catch Leon up on everything later, but since he was officially the gamma, he had to be aware of what was going on.

When I was done explaining what happened, I suggested we start a war. I know what you’re thinking, Amelia, but hear me out. I wasn’t going to just break my own laws without reason.

Katrina didn’t really want to start a war with Colton, because she didn’t have an army. And she didn’t want him thinking she was going to. That’s why she wanted to convince him to join forces with her. My thought was to attack and make Colton think Katrina set him up. That way, they would take each other out. If not, they would definitely weaken each other and we could finish the job.

I went over my plan. Jordan called it shitty and everyone agreed with him. But, it was an opportunity to get ahead. I planned to bring Grandpa with me, so he could take out Katrina himself. I assigned Miranda’s team to raid their hideout and capture Jason and Erica.

I was only bringing Sadie so she could absorb more fae magic and make charms. Grandpa would sell the story of it being a set up. Farrah would change my appearance, and everyone else would be on standby.

Carl’s team would assist me. Christopher’s team, along with Devyn, would set up around us and make sure no one got away. They were snipers after all. And they were good. No one agreed with my plan, but we did it anyway. And I went to pick up Grandpa.

Grandpa didn’t need details, just revenge. In three sentences, I told him the ploy and he was ready.

The goddesses must have heard my prayers because Colton and Katrina were already talking when we got there, and they were not on good terms. It couldn’t have been more perfect.

I hid in the shadows, listening and watching for the right moment. Carl’s team attacked. Colton instantly, without a doubt, assumed Katrina was behind it. Then Grandpa barged in, acted like Katrina’s lover, and confirmed that he was attacking, just like she instructed him to. It was too perfect.

Colton attacked Katrina. However, Ryan defended her, claiming she was his mate. After taking a closer look, I saw Katrina was marked by Ryan. It didn’t make sense. But Ryan attacking Colton left her alone. And Grandpa was itching for revenge.

~Mom
